Business roof inspection services involve a comprehensive assessment of a commercial property's roofing system to identify potential issues and evaluate its overall condition. These inspections typically include visual examinations of the roof surface, drainage systems, flashing, seams, and other critical components. Some service providers may also utilize specialized equipment or drone technology to access hard-to-reach areas and gather detailed imagery. The goal is to detect signs of damage, wear, or deterioration early, helping property owners plan maintenance or repairs before problems escalate.

The primary problems addressed through professional roof inspections include leaks, water intrusion, structural weaknesses, and material degradation. Identifying these issues in their early stages can prevent costly repairs, reduce downtime, and extend the lifespan of the roofing system. Inspections can also uncover underlying problems such as poor installation, ventilation issues, or accumulated debris that might compromise the roof’s integrity over time. Regular inspections are especially valuable for maintaining the safety and functionality of a commercial property’s roof, ensuring it continues to provide effective protection.

Commercial properties that commonly utilize roof inspection services include office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, industrial facilities, and multi-unit residential complexes. These properties often have large or complex roof structures that require specialized knowledge to evaluate properly. Regular inspections are especially important for buildings with flat roofs, which are more prone to drainage issues and ponding water, as well as for properties in areas with harsh weather conditions that can accelerate wear and tear.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for a comprehensive roof inspection ranges from $200 to $500,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s in Castleton On Hudson may cost closer to $500, while smaller roofs may be around $200.

Service Fees - Service fees for roof inspections usually vary between $150 and $400, with some local providers offering package deals. Factors influencing costs include roof height, accessibility, and the extent of inspection required.

Additional Charges - Additional charges may apply for detailed reports or specialized inspections, often adding $100 to $300 to the base cost. These fees depend on the scope of inspection and specific client needs.

Cost Variability - Overall costs for business roof inspections can vary widely, with typical ranges from $150 to $600. Contact local service providers to obtain accurate estimates based on specific roof conditions and inspection requ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
